PA9T GF50 (50% Glass Fiber Reinforced)
Table of Contents
PA9T GF50 is an advanced aromatic polyamide reinforced with 50% glass fiber. It offers exceptional performance in high-heat environments with a melting point of 306°C and a heat deflection temperature (HDT) of 285°C. Unlike PA6T, PA9T has a longer carbon chain, providing even lower water absorption (0.15% at equilibrium). This ensures extreme dimensional stability and superior chemical resistance to automotive oils. It is the ideal metal replacement for critical EV power systems, high-voltage connectors, and engine-room structural components.

PA9T GF50 High-Temp Nylon for Motor Oil Cooling Pipe Brackets
PA9T GF50 is a 50% glass-fiber reinforced PPA. It has a 306°C melting point. This material resists hot motor oil up to 120°C. It secures cooling pipes in EV and industrial motors. The bracket reduces noise and stops heavy vibration. It prevents oil leaks by keeping pipes in the right place. Low moisture uptake keeps the bracket precise and stable. Processing: Injection mold at 310-330°C. Keep mold temperature between 130-150°C. As a factory-direct supplier, we offer durable solutions for motor cooling.
PA9T GF50 High-Voltage Nylon for Connector Cores
PA9T GF50 is a top choice for EV high-voltage systems. It handles high currents and thousands of volts safely. The material has a high CTI to stop electrical tracking. Its low moisture uptake (0.17%) keeps dimensions perfect for a tight fit. This prevents overheating and keeps contact resistance below 50μΩ. It supports IP67 and IP6K9K seals against water and dust. High stiffness protects the core under mechanical stress. Processing: Melt temperature 315-335°C. Pre-dry for 4-6 hours before use. Our factory provides high-purity PA9T for energy storage safety.
PA9T GF50 High-Impact Nylon for Battery Module Crossbeams
PA9T GF50 is a 50% GF structural nylon for battery modules. It carries heavy loads and resists cell expansion forces. It meets GB 38031 safety standards for high impact. The 18,000 MPa modulus keeps module positioning stable. This creates clear space for cooling air and cables. High heat resistance slows down fire spread during thermal runaway. It is much lighter than metal and resists battery chemicals. Processing: Use 130-150°C mold temperature for best results. We provide rugged, automotive-grade PA9T for battery structural safety.
